About A. Hamada
A. Hamada is a scholar working on Plant Science, Materials Chemistry,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Molecular Biology and Agronomy and Crop Science, having authored 74 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Plant Stress Responses and Tolerance (21 papers), Plant Micronutrient Interactions and Effects (16 papers), Aluminum toxicity and tolerance in plants and animals (8 papers), Crop Yield and Soil Fertility (6 papers), Seed Germination and Physiology (5 papers), Fuel Cells and Related Materials (5 papers), Magnetic and Electromagnetic Effects (5 papers) and Plant nutrient uptake and metabolism (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Plant Science (933 citations), Catalysis (140 citations), Biophysics (89 citations), Soil Science (87 citations) and Agronomy and Crop Science (79 citations). A. Hamada has collaborated with scholars based in Egypt, Japan and Yemen. Frequent co-authors include O Sueoka, A.E. El-Enany, Hideo Utsumi, Shingo Ishida, S. Imamura, Naoki Okamoto, C. M. Kunin, Duane D. Miller, Stephen T. Chambers and Yuri Miura. Their work appears in journals such as Biologia Plantarum, Solid State Communications, The Journal of Chemical Physics, Water Science & Technology and Journal of Physics B Atomic Molecular and Optical Physics.
